在GitHub上搜索前端面试题的有效方法

在如今的技术快速发展的时代,前端开发者不仅需要具备扎实的编程基础,还需了解各种面试问题,以便在面试中脱颖而出。GitHub作为一个开放的代码托管平台,提供了丰富的资源和项目,特别是在前端面试题的整理和分享方面。本文将深入探讨如何在GitHub上高效搜索和利用前端面试题。

1. GitHub搜索基本概念

在GitHub上进行搜索的基础是理解搜索框的功能和语法。用户可以通过关键词用户等多种方式来进行搜索。对于前端面试题,我们通常使用如下搜索方法:

  • 关键词搜索:直接在搜索框输入相关关键词,如“前端面试题”。
  • 高级搜索:利用搜索过滤器,比如使用language:JavaScript来限制结果为JavaScript相关的项目。

2. 如何有效搜索前端面试题

2.1 使用关键字

在搜索前端面试题时,可以使用一些特定的关键词组合,例如:

  • Frontend Interview Questions
  • Frontend Interview Challenges
  • 前端面试题整理

2.2 利用标签和分类

许多GitHub项目会对其内容进行标签(Tags)和分类,使用这些标签能帮助你更快找到相关的面试题。例如,可以在搜索时添加topic:interview或者查找awesome系列的项目。

2.3 查看热门项目

在GitHub上,可以通过浏览Trending页面来查找当前最受欢迎的前端面试题库。这些项目通常是由大量用户关注和推荐的,可信度高。

3. 推荐的GitHub前端面试题项目

3.1 Frontend-Interview-Questions

  • 项目链接Frontend-Interview-Questions
  • 项目特点:这个项目汇集了大量前端面试问题,分类明确,包括基础知识、框架相关、工具等。

3.2 Awesome-Interview-Questions

  • 项目链接Awesome-Interview-Questions
  • 项目特点:包含各个技术栈的面试题,前端部分非常丰富,适合各类开发者使用。

4. 在GitHub上自学前端面试题

4.1 参与讨论

许多面试题库下方会有评论区,参与这些讨论不仅可以加深理解,还能通过他人的分享获取新的视角。

4.2 Fork和Star

在找到适合的项目后,可以选择Fork来保存自己的代码库,便于日后参考。同时,给项目Star是对开源贡献者的支持。

5. FAQ – 常见问题解答

5.1 如何找到高质量的前端面试题?

高质量的前端面试题通常集中在受欢迎的开源项目中。可以关注GitHub的Trending项目,并筛选出相关标签的项目。

5.2 GitHub上有没有推荐的前端面试题集?

是的,GitHub上有很多优秀的前端面试题集,比如Frontend-Interview-QuestionsAwesome-Interview-Questions,它们的内容丰富且更新频繁。

5.3 如何高效利用GitHub上的面试题?

可以通过定期查阅和练习这些面试题,利用GitHub的评论和讨论区了解他人的解题思路,从而提升自己的面试能力。

5.4 是否有针对特定框架的面试题库?

是的,许多项目专门针对如React、Vue等框架的面试题,搜索时可使用React Interview QuestionsVue Interview Questions等关键词。

6. 结语

在GitHub上搜索和利用前端面试题是提升个人技术能力的重要方式。通过掌握搜索技巧和选择合适的项目,可以高效地准备面试,提高求职成功率。希望本文能为你提供一些有用的帮助,让你在前端开发的面试中获得理想的表现。

正文完